Key Components of Mental Health Assessments

Mental health assessments generally involve different components to form a holistic view of a person's psychological state. These components may consist of:

  • Clinical Interviews: Structured discussions between the clinician and customer to gather comprehensive info relating to signs, history, and context of the individual's mental health.

  • Standardized Questionnaires: Various scales and questionnaires assess specific symptoms or disorders. These tools provide measurable data that can help in detecting conditions.

  • Observational Assessments: Clinicians might observe a client's habits in various settings to assess their social functionality and interaction skills.

  • Security Information: Gaining insights from member of the family, pals, or previous treatments can offer extra perspectives on the person's condition.

Common Mental Health Assessment Tools

Below is a table describing some common standardized assessment tools made use of in mental health evaluations:

Assessment ToolPurposeSecret Features
Beck Depression Inventory (BDI)Measures the severity of depression21-item self-report questionnaire
Generalized Anxiety Disorder 7 (GAD-7)Evaluates anxiety severity7-question self-report scale
Hamilton Rating Scale for Depression (HAM-D)Clinician-administered scale examining depressive symptoms17-21 product structured interview
Mini-Mental State Examination (MMSE)Assesses cognitive problems30-item test covering different cognitive domains
Patient Health Questionnaire-9 (PHQ-9)Screens for depression and evaluates intensity9-item self-report tool

The Mental Health Evaluation Process

The process of mental health evaluation can be laid out in several essential steps:

  1. Initial Contact: The evaluation usually begins with a clinician or mental health professional performing an initial interview or assessment to understand the reasons for the evaluation.

  2. Event Information: The clinician collects details about the person's history, existing signs, household background, and social characteristics. This action might consist of reviewing any previous assessments and treatments.

  3. Choice of Assessment Tools: Based on the initial information, the clinician chooses suitable assessment instruments and questionnaires customized to particular concerns.

  4. Execution: The selected tools are administered, either through self-report, structured interviews, or observational approaches.

  5. Analysis and Interpretation: The gathered data is evaluated to supply a comprehensive understanding of the person's mental health status.

  6. Feedback and Recommendations: Finally, the clinician provides feedback to the individual and may advise treatment options or additional assessments based on findings.

Treatment Considerations Based on Evaluation Results

Once the evaluation is complete and outcomes are analyzed, various treatment alternatives might be suggested based upon identified mental health problems. Possible treatment opportunities include:

  • Psychotherapy: Various methods,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), interpersonal therapy, and d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), can be efficient.

  • Medications: Psychiatric medications might be prescribed to manage symptoms, such as antidepressants, anxiolytics, or state of mind stabilizers.

  • Support system: Peer support can offer additional emotional backing and useful recommendations.

  • Way of life Changes: Encouraging healthier way of life options, such as physical activity, nutrition, and sleep health, can substantially impact mental well-being.
